Output 2500023eba94b1041ca152ac425d98a4eb792fcb35094804c737c14c87174ec3:24

value
68483
script pubkey
OP_0 OP_PUSHBYTES_20 818e0d632baf1d3f1f58f2392f14168a25b0ee49
address
bc1qsx8q6cet4uwn786c7guj79qk3gjmpmjfez8va6
transaction
2500023eba94b1041ca152ac425d98a4eb792fcb35094804c737c14c87174ec3
spent
true